I'll make this one a race to the swift (and the American, probably) and pitch an easy baseball trivia question, in honor of the start of the baseball season this week.

1941 was not a good summer for much of the world, but in the USA it was still the last summer before the war. Baseball proved highly diverting from global tragedies that summer, why?

Jackie Robinson broke the color barrier in 1947, so I know that isn't it. Babe Ruth's single season home run record was broken by Roger Maris in 1961, so I know that isn't it. The only other really major event I can think of is Joe DiMaggio's 56 consecutive games. Was that in 1941? I'm also guessing the year Lou Gehrig died was 1941.

It is also the year my grandfather could have played professional baseball. When he was 14 he used to play baseball on a men's league. When he was 17 (in 1941) a scout for the Washington Senators saw him play and wanted to sign him, but his dad said no. He was still in high school, and his dad said he would have to graduate first. Then the U.S. entered WWII and my grandpa joined the army (or was drafted) and got hurt while playing baseball in the Philippines, so he never played as a pro.

You're right about Joe DiMaggio's streak, which occured in 1941. For the non-Yanks, DiMaggio got a hit in 56 consecutive games; it is believed to be an unbreakable record.
